2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-4-piperidone

CAS 826-36-8 · C9H17NO
Hazard class
Danger — Corrosive, Irritant / harmful, Health hazard
Pictograms
CorrosiveIrritant / harmfulHealth hazard
H-statements
  • H290 May be corrosive to metals
  • H302 Harmful if swallowed
  • H314 Causes severe skin burns and eye damage
  • H315 Causes skin irritation
  • H317 May cause an allergic skin reaction
  • H318 Causes serious eye damage
  • H319 Causes serious eye irritation
  • H335 May cause respiratory irritation
  • H412 Harmful to aquatic life with long lasting effects
  • H371 May cause damage to organs
Synonyms
212-554-2 · Triacetonamine · 2,2,6,6-Tetramethyl-4-piperidone · Vincubine · Tempidon · TMPone · 2K4430S3XP · IKH-19
Molecular weight
155.24 g/mol
